Types Of Insoles Used

NBA players put immense stress on their feet during games. The right insoles can make a huge difference. Players use different types of insoles to improve performance and comfort. These insoles provide support, reduce fatigue, and prevent injuries.

Custom Orthotics

Many NBA players prefer custom orthotics. These insoles are made specifically for their feet. A podiatrist or specialist creates them after analyzing the player’s foot structure. They offer perfect support and fit. Custom orthotics help with alignment issues. They also address specific foot problems like plantar fasciitis or flat feet.

Off-the-shelf Insoles

Some players use off-the-shelf insoles. These are ready-made and available in stores. They come in various sizes and designs. Off-the-shelf insoles provide good support and cushioning. They are easy to replace and cost less than custom orthotics. Many brands offer high-quality options. Players often choose ones with extra arch support or shock absorption.

Materials In Nba Insoles

NBA players rely on insoles to protect their feet and enhance performance. These insoles consist of various materials, each offering unique benefits. The right material can make a big difference in comfort and support.

Foam And Gel

Foam is a popular choice for NBA insoles. It provides excellent cushioning. Memory foam molds to the shape of the foot. This ensures a custom fit and reduces pressure points. Gel insoles offer shock absorption. They help in reducing impact during jumps and quick movements. Gel distributes weight evenly across the foot, making it ideal for players who need extra support.

Carbon Fiber

Carbon fiber is another material used in NBA insoles. It is lightweight yet strong. This material offers great support without adding bulk. Carbon fiber insoles are stiff. They help in maintaining foot alignment. This reduces the risk of injuries. Players can move quickly and efficiently on the court with carbon fiber insoles.

Customization For Individual Needs

NBA players demand the best from their insoles. Customization is key. Each player’s foot is unique. Proper insole customization helps prevent injuries and boosts performance. Let’s explore the steps involved in creating these custom insoles.

Foot Shape Analysis

First, experts analyze the player’s foot shape. This process includes 3D scanning. It captures the exact contours of the foot. Professionals then review the data. They look for any abnormalities. This ensures the insole fits perfectly.

Step Details
3D Scanning Captures exact foot contours
Data Review Identifies abnormalities

Biomechanical Adjustments

Next, biomechanical adjustments are made. These adjustments address specific needs. Some players need extra arch support. Others need heel cushioning. Experts customize insoles based on these needs.

  • Arch Support: Helps with flat feet or high arches
  • Heel Cushioning: Reduces impact stress

By focusing on these details, insoles provide better support. This leads to fewer injuries and improved performance. The process is complex but crucial.

Future Of Insole Technology

The future of insole technology is bright. NBA players are at the forefront of these innovations. Advanced insoles promise better performance and comfort. They are essential for athletes who push their bodies to the limit.

Innovations In Design

Recent innovations focus on custom fitting and materials. Insoles are now made with 3D printing. This allows for a perfect fit for each player. Custom fits reduce the risk of injury.

Materials have also improved. New foams and gels provide better cushioning and support. Some insoles even have sensors. These sensors track movement and pressure. Data from these sensors helps create better designs.

Impact On Player Performance

Better insoles can improve player performance. Comfort and support are key. Players with good insoles can play longer and harder. Reduced pain and fatigue lead to better performance on the court.

Insoles with sensors offer real-time feedback. Players can adjust their movements based on this data. This leads to better training and reduced risk of injury.
